  1. // ArduinoJson - arduinojson.org
  2. // Copyright Benoit Blanchon 2014-2018
  3. // MIT License
  4. #include <ArduinoJson.h>
  5. #include <catch.hpp>
  6. TEST_CASE("DynamicJsonDocument") {
  7. DynamicJsonDocument doc;
  8. SECTION("serializeJson()") {
  9. JsonObject obj = doc.to<JsonObject>();
  10. obj["hello"] = "world";
  11. std::string json;
  12. serializeJson(doc, json);
  13. REQUIRE(json == "{\"hello\":\"world\"}");
  14. }
  15. SECTION("memoryUsage()") {
  16. SECTION("starts at zero") {
  17. REQUIRE(doc.memoryUsage() == 0);
  18. }
  19. SECTION("JSON_ARRAY_SIZE(0)") {
  20. doc.to<JsonArray>();
  21. REQUIRE(doc.memoryUsage() == JSON_ARRAY_SIZE(0));
  22. }
  23. SECTION("JSON_ARRAY_SIZE(1)") {
  24. doc.to<JsonArray>().add(42);
  25. REQUIRE(doc.memoryUsage() == JSON_ARRAY_SIZE(1));
  26. }
  27. SECTION("JSON_ARRAY_SIZE(1) + JSON_ARRAY_SIZE(0)") {
  28. doc.to<JsonArray>().createNestedArray();
  29. REQUIRE(doc.memoryUsage() == JSON_ARRAY_SIZE(1) + JSON_ARRAY_SIZE(0));
  30. }
  31. }
  32. SECTION("capacity()") {
  33. SECTION("matches constructor argument") {
  34. DynamicJsonDocument doc2(256);
  35. REQUIRE(doc2.capacity() == 256);
  36. }
  37. SECTION("rounds up constructor argument") {
  38. DynamicJsonDocument doc2(253);
  39. REQUIRE(doc2.capacity() == 256);
  40. }
  41. }
  42. SECTION("Copy constructor") {
  43. deserializeJson(doc, "{\"hello\":\"world\"}");
  44. doc.nestingLimit = 42;
  45. DynamicJsonDocument doc2 = doc;
  46. std::string json;
  47. serializeJson(doc2, json);
  48. REQUIRE(json == "{\"hello\":\"world\"}");
  49. REQUIRE(doc2.nestingLimit == 42);
  50. }
  51. SECTION("Copy assignment") {
  52. DynamicJsonDocument doc2;
  53. deserializeJson(doc2, "{\"hello\":\"world\"}");
  54. doc2.nestingLimit = 42;
  55. doc = doc2;
  56. std::string json;
  57. serializeJson(doc, json);
  58. REQUIRE(json == "{\"hello\":\"world\"}");
  59. REQUIRE(doc.nestingLimit == 42);
  60. }
  61. SECTION("Construct from StaticJsonDocument") {
  62. StaticJsonDocument<200> sdoc;
  63. deserializeJson(sdoc, "{\"hello\":\"world\"}");
  64. sdoc.nestingLimit = 42;
  65. DynamicJsonDocument ddoc = sdoc;
  66. std::string json;
  67. serializeJson(ddoc, json);
  68. REQUIRE(json == "{\"hello\":\"world\"}");
  69. REQUIRE(ddoc.nestingLimit == 42);
  70. }
  71. SECTION("Assign from StaticJsonDocument") {
  72. DynamicJsonDocument ddoc;
  73. ddoc.to<JsonVariant>().set(666);
  74. StaticJsonDocument<200> sdoc;
  75. deserializeJson(sdoc, "{\"hello\":\"world\"}");
  76. sdoc.nestingLimit = 42;
  77. ddoc = sdoc;
  78. std::string json;
  79. serializeJson(ddoc, json);
  80. REQUIRE(json == "{\"hello\":\"world\"}");
  81. REQUIRE(ddoc.nestingLimit == 42);
  82. }
  83. SECTION("memoryUsage()") {
  84. SECTION("Increases after adding value to array") {
  85. JsonArray arr = doc.to<JsonArray>();
  86. REQUIRE(doc.memoryUsage() == JSON_ARRAY_SIZE(0));
  87. arr.add(42);
  88. REQUIRE(doc.memoryUsage() == JSON_ARRAY_SIZE(1));
  89. arr.add(43);
  90. REQUIRE(doc.memoryUsage() == JSON_ARRAY_SIZE(2));
  91. }
  92. SECTION("Increases after adding value to object") {
  93. JsonObject obj = doc.to<JsonObject>();
  94. REQUIRE(doc.memoryUsage() == JSON_OBJECT_SIZE(0));
  95. obj["a"] = 1;
  96. REQUIRE(doc.memoryUsage() == JSON_OBJECT_SIZE(1));
  97. obj["b"] = 2;
  98. REQUIRE(doc.memoryUsage() == JSON_OBJECT_SIZE(2));
  99. }
  100. }
  101. }
